The Global Consumer Electronic Biometrics Market size is expected to reach $24.50 billion by 2032, rising at a market growth of 20.0% CAGR during the forecast period.

Consumers value the seamless experience of unlocking devices or authorizing actions with a single touch or glance, which has cemented single-factor authentication as the default choice in many mainstream products. Despite the growing awareness of security threats, the trade-off for faster and more intuitive user experiences continues to keep single-factor authentication at the forefront of the market.

The major strategies followed by the market participants are Product Launches as the key developmental strategy to keep pace with the changing demands of end users. For instance, In July, 2024, Samsung Electronics Co., Ltd. unveiled its first smart ring, the Galaxy Ring, featuring advanced biometric health monitoring like sleep, heart rate, and stress tracking. It integrates seamlessly with Samsung's ecosystem and offers competitive features and pricing compared to the Oura Ring, targeting health-conscious and tech-savvy consumers seeking comprehensive wellness wearables. Additionally, In January, 2025, IDEMIA SAS unveiled a USB-C device enabling biometric payment card enrollment via smartphones, simplifying fingerprint registration. The biometric data stays securely on the card, removing PIN use. Supported by Mastercard and Visa, this innovation aims to boost the global adoption of biometric payment cards by offering a user-friendly enrollment experience.

COVID 19 Impact Analysis

During the COVID-19 pandemic, the market faced significant disruptions due to global supply chain interruptions. Factory shutdowns in key manufacturing hubs, such as China and Southeast Asia, resulted in delays in the production and delivery of biometric components, including fingerprint sensors and facial recognition modules. Many electronics manufacturers struggled to source critical parts, leading to postponed product launches and reduced availability of devices in retail markets. Thus, the COVID-19 pandemic had a negative impact on the market.

Market Growth Factors

Over the past decade, security breaches, identity thefts, and cyberattacks have grown both in frequency and sophistication, making digital security a top priority for consumers and organizations alike. In a digital-first world where personal data is exchanged rapidly and often, people have become more aware of the vulnerabilities associated with traditional password and PIN-based systems. Biometrics-such as fingerprint recognition, facial authentication, and voice recognition-offer a more secure, personal, and hard-to-replicate alternative for user authentication. Thus, cyber threats evolve and digital lifestyles become more pervasive, the demand for secure and privacy-oriented solutions continues to push biometric technologies to the forefront of the market.

Additionally, the global surge in connected devices, including smartphones, smartwatches, fitness trackers, smart home hubs, and voice assistants, has fundamentally transformed how individuals interact with technology. This proliferation, commonly referred to as the Internet of Things (IoT), creates a vast ecosystem where seamless interoperability and intuitive user experiences are paramount. In conclusion, as the IoT ecosystem expands and connected devices permeate every aspect of modern living, biometrics is rapidly becoming the default authentication solution.

Market Restraining Factors

While biometrics are celebrated for their potential to enhance security, the paradox is that they introduce unique privacy and data protection challenges that act as a significant restraint on their widespread adoption. Unlike passwords, biometric identifiers such as fingerprints, facial features, or voice patterns are inherently personal and immutable. Once compromised, they cannot be changed or reset. This permanence raises major concerns among consumers and privacy advocates alike. Thus, despite their promise, privacy and data security concerns remain a profound restraint on the mass adoption of biometrics in consumer electronics.

Value Chain Analysis

The value chain of the consumer electronics biometrics market begins with raw material and component suppliers who provide essential hardware elements. These are utilized by biometric technology developers to create core recognition systems like fingerprint and facial sensors. OEMs and device manufacturers then integrate these technologies into consumer products. Software integrators and system developers enhance device functionality through tailored applications and security protocols. Distribution and retail channels deliver the products to end users/consumers, who rely on them for secure, seamless digital experiences. Finally, after-sales services and support ensure continued customer satisfaction and feed insights back into development.

Security Level Outlook

Based on security level, the market is characterized into single-factor authentication and multi-factor authentication. The multi-factor authentication segment procured 38% revenue share in the market in 2024. Multi-factor authentication combines two or more distinct verification methods-such as pairing biometrics with passwords, PINs, or additional biometric modalities-to provide an extra layer of security. This approach has gained traction in scenarios where higher levels of protection are required, such as in mobile payments, access to sensitive data, or enterprise device usage.

Technology Outlook

On the basis of technology, the market is classified into fingerprint recognition, facial recognition, voice recognition, iris recognition, and others. The facial recognition segment garnered 27% revenue share in the market in 2024. This segment has seen rapid adoption due to the increasing popularity of contactless and highly convenient security solutions, particularly in smartphones, tablets, and laptops. Modern facial recognition systems use advanced algorithms and 3D imaging technologies to accurately identify users, even in varying lighting conditions.

Device Type Outlook

By device type, the market is divided into smartphones, laptops, wearables, tablets, and others. The laptops segment garnered 18% revenue share in the market in 2024. The rising trend of remote work, online education, and digital content creation has increased the need for secure and convenient device access. As a result, laptop manufacturers are increasingly embedding biometric features like fingerprint scanners and facial recognition into their devices.

Application Outlook

Based on application, the market is segmented into authentication & access control, mobile payments & digital wallets, device security & anti-theft measures, parental controls & usage restrictions, and others. The rapid global adoption of digital payment solutions has accelerated the integration of biometrics to ensure secure, frictionless transactions. Biometric authentication, particularly fingerprint and facial recognition, has become a standard security feature in mobile payment platforms and digital wallets.

Regional Outlook

Region-wise, the market is analyzed across North America, Europe, Asia Pacific, and LAMEA. The North America segment recorded 35% revenue share in the market in 2024. The region's strong market position is underpinned by its rapid technological adoption, high consumer awareness, and the presence of major global players in the electronics and biometrics sectors. Consumers in North America have embraced biometric technologies for everyday use, with widespread integration in smartphones, wearables, laptops, and smart home devices.
